Question: On a recent CT (1-14-19) of pulmonary (lungs)
Results were linear bandlike pulmonary
opacities;scattered foci of linear opacities
subsegmental atelectasis. Trace right
pleural effusion. What does all means
regarding my lungs. No result of pneumonia
noted.

Brief Answer:
Possibility of old sequel is more likely.
Detailed Answer:
Thanks for your question on Ask a doctor forum.
I can understand your concern.
I have gone through the CT report you have mentioned.
This CT picture is commonly seen with sequel of lung infection.
It is also seen with smokers.
Atelectesis is partial collapse of part of lung and it is commonly seen with retained secretions.
So please let me know
1. Do you smoke?
2. Do you have history of pneumonia?
Please reply me answers of above asked questions, so that I can guide you better. I will be happy to help you further. Wish you good health. Thanks.
